Overview:

Transparent Hands plans to collaborate with Life hospital in organizing a free medical camp in Pindi Rajpootan, Kot Lakhpat, Lahore. In this medical camp, our team of expert physicians will provide the following health facilities to deserving patients:

  1. Free consultation and provision of medicines
  2. Free treatment of medical and surgical cases
  3. Free Hepatitis B and C screening
  4. Free BSR and Blood Pressure tests
  5. Free ophthalmological consultation and provision of glasses.
  6. Free Tuberculosis screening

Challenges:

For the past three years, Lahore has been shuffling between the top two ranks of world’s most polluted cities. Smog epidemic has added a new chapter of ophthalmological and respiratory diseases to the citizens’ lives. Poor air quality results in numerous adverse effects on general health and wellbeing of the residents, especially affecting those living in remote areas or slums. It is common knowledge that poor living standards result in adverse effects on general health and wellbeing of the residents, causing short-term illnesses such as eye, nose, and throat infections, Hepatitis, Diabetes and Hypertension. Over time, the mentioned illnesses have the potential of becoming acute and may lead to ophthalmological complications including acute Uveitis, numerous cardiorespiratory issues and a variety of cancers. Few diseases mentioned above, after worsening over time, may even prove to be fatal. Presently, COVID-19 has added another dimension to the pre-existing challenges. The public health sector is burdened to its maximum capacity. Due to saturation of patients at public hospitals, and provision of limited health care facilities, most diseases are going unnoticed and therefore remain untreated.

Transparent Hands, in collaboration with Life Hospital organized and managed a free Medical and Surgical camp on March 14, 2021, at Govt. Boys High School, At Pindi Stop, Pindi Rajputan Kot Lakhpat, Lahore. This camp was set up for the underprivileged residing in the said locality. The camp team consisted of 24 members including two supervisors, nine doctors (two male and seven female), two pharmacists, two lab technologists, two patient registrars, one female nurse, two photographers, and four crew workers. Free face masks were distributed among the patients and all other attendees. Testing facilities for Hepatitis B and C, basic eye exam, eye Cataracts, blood sugar level, and blood pressure were provided. In total 300 patients were provided with a free consultation, medicines, and prescribed eye-glasses.

The medical camp organized by Transparent Hands has played an instrumental role in assisting 300 patients that turned up at Govt. Boys High School, At Pindi Stop, Pindi Rajputan Kot Lakhpat, Lahore. Majority of the cases examined by the doctors, constituted of patients suffering from allergies. Two surgical cases, ten eye cataract removal, and three Hepatitis C positive cases have been registered with us. Further medical and surgical care shall be provided to the said registered patients in association with Life Hospital.  In the future, we look forward to organizing such camps where we can be of service to the underprivileged patients in Pakistan and facilitate them with health care.
